Man dies after stabbing; suspect arrested

A MAN died from stab wounds suffered Saturday night in Garden Grove.

UPDATE: The victim in Saturday’s stabbing has died and a suspect has been arrested. According to Garden Grove police, the deceased is Ruben J. Murga, 25, of Santa Ana. The suspect, now booked and charged with murder, is Michael J. Martinez, 31, of Santa Ana. Murga died at UCI Medical Center in Orange from his wounds.

–––––––––

A man was hospitalized Saturday night with stab wounds after an “altercation” in Garden Grove. According to Sgt. Ray Bex of the GGPD, the incident took place in the 13300 block of Lily Street around 10:30 p.m.

Arriving police officers found a victim – described as an Hispanic male, 25 to 30 years old – lying on the sidewalk and bleeding from stabbings. He was treated at the scene by Garden Grove Fire Department paramedics and taken to an area hospital.

According to Sgt. Bex, investigators believe the victim was involved in “an altercation with  several people and was stabbed during that time.”

Lily Street is located in a tract northwest of Trask Avenue and Fairview Street in the southeast of the city.
